Who is Cameron Gibson?
Cameron Gibson is a New Zealand swimming competitor. He won a bronze medal in the 200m backstroke at the 2006 Commonwealth Games in a time of 2:00.72 minutes.
He also competed at the 2004 Olympic Games and the 2008 Olympic Games. In the latter he swam the final, freestyle, leg for the New Zealand team which finish fifth in the final of Men's 4 x 100 metre medley relay.
